Skip to content

junyealim/chatbot

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

👶 챗쪽이

나와 배우자의 성격을 기반으로 생성되는 AI 챗봇
인원: 5명
기간: 2024-01-12 ~ 2024-02-20

💡 프로젝트 기획

한 가정에 한 아이만 낳는 시대에, 그 하나뿐인 아이에 대한, 부모님들의 기대와 관심은, 더욱 높아지고 있습니다. 이런 관심들을 자극하는 아이의 미래 얼굴을 예측 서비스나, 미래 기질을 예상해주는 상품들도 굉장히 많은 인기를 끌고 있습니다. 저희 팀은 이런 사실을 이용하여 부모로서, 미래의 자녀에 대한 상상을 충족하고 궁금증을 해소할 수 있는 앱을 구현해보았습니다.


👪 Process & Role

Overall Process

- 기획, 데이터 작성, 모델학습, 프론트구현, 서버구현, 서버배포, PPT제작, 발표

😺 My Role

- 기획, 데이터 작성, 모델학습, PPT제작, 발표

🌏 Dataset & Model

Dataset

  • 일상 질문900개에 성격별로 각 다른 대답 작성

  • 성격은 5개의 카테고리로 총 10개.

  • 느긋/급함, 내향/외향, 낙천/불안, 고집/우유부단, 이성적/감성적

  • 총 9000개의 질문-대답 형식의 데이터셋 작성

    image

Model 🚀

  • 문장 학습 모델

  • GPT2LMHeadModel.from_pretrained(skt/kogpt2-base-v2)

  • GPT2LMHeadModel 클래스에서 사전 훈련된 'skt/kogpt2-base-버전2' 모델을 불러옴

    image




앱설명 🎨

image

image

image

image


🌈 Result

image

  • 성격별로 다른 대답이 생성됨.
  • 반반으로 골고루 선택된 성격은 가중치를 줄이고 한쪽으로 선택이 쏠린 성격의 출력 가중치를 높히는 알고리즘을 생성.
  • 사용자가 선택한 성격이 적절히 섞여서 대답이 출력됨.

⚙️ Skills & Tools

              

              

About

성격 기반 AI 챗봇_챗쪽이

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ors